IT services company Atos has appointed Ursula Morgenstern as CEO for Atos UK & Ireland, and Group Executive committee member from 1 January 2012.

Ursula will be responsible for driving the strategic direction of Atos in the UK & Ireland to ensure high quality service delivery to clients, and continued business growth.

Ursula will replace Keith Wilman, who wants to retire from his position as UK & Ireland CEO and Keith will be appointed Chairman for Atos UK & Ireland. In addition, Keith will become a special advisor to Thierry Breton, Chairman and CEO of Atos.

Ursula Morgenstern joined Atos in 2002 through the acquisition of KPMG Consulting. Previously, Ursula acted as UK and Ireland Chief Operating Officer.

Before assuming the role of UK CEO earlier this year, from 2009 Ursula was senior vice-president responsible for Private Sector Markets, and from 2007 she was senior vice-president responsible for Systems Integration.

Atos chairman and CEO Thierry Breton said Ursula brings immense business experience and technology expertise and he is confident that Ursula will continue the strong track record of Keith Wilman, to ensure further success in the UK and Ireland for Atos.

"She is assuming her role at an exciting time for the UK business, which grew in size by 50% following the integration of Siemens IT Solutions and Services earlier this year," said Breton.
